Tokenim 是一种基于区块链的解决方案,旨在简化和数字资产的创建及管理流程。无论你是区块链开发者还是希望进入加密货币领域的初学者,安装和配置 Tokenim 是一项必不可少的步骤。本文将详细介绍 Tokenim 的安装过程,并解答用户在配置过程中可能遇到的一些常见问题。

Tokenim 的特点

在推动加密货币和区块链技术发展的过程中,Tokenim 提供了一系列独特的功能,使其成为区块链开发者的首选工具。首先,Tokenim 提供了用户友好的界面,简化了数字资产的创建过程。其次,它支持智能合约功能,使得用户可以在区块链上执行复杂的交易。此外,Tokenim 还具备可扩展性,适应不同规模的项目需求。这些特点使得 Tokenim 在众多区块链解决方案中脱颖而出。

安装 Tokenim 的准备工作

在开始安装 Tokenim 之前,用户需要确保满足某些系统要求。首先,检查你的操作系统,Tokenim 支持主要的操作系统,包括 Windows、macOS 和 Linux。其次,确保你的计算机拥有稳定的互联网连接,以便顺利下载所需的文件。最后,建议用户提前安装 Git 和 Node.js,因为它们是许多区块链开发工具的必备组件。

Tokenim 的安装步骤

安装 Tokenim 的过程相对简单,用户只需按照以下步骤进行操作:

  1. 打开终端或命令提示符,根据你的操作系统选择适当的工具。
  2. 使用 Git 克隆 Tokenim 的官方仓库。在终端中输入以下命令:
    git clone https://github.com/tokenim/tokenim.git
  3. 进入克隆下来的目录:
    cd tokenim
  4. 安装依赖包。使用 npm 安装所需的 Node.js 库:
    npm install
  5. 完成后,启动 Tokenim 服务:
    npm start

通过以上步骤,用户应该能够成功安装并启动 Tokenim。

Tokenim 的配置

安装完成后,接下来是配置 Tokenim。配置过程包括设置数据库、网络参数以及用户权限等。一些常见的配置项包括:

  • 数据库连接:用户需要在配置文件中指定数据库的类型和连接字符串,以便 Tokenim 可以访问和存储数据。
  • 网络设置:根据项目需求,用户可以选择运行在测试网络还是主网络,并在配置文件中进行相应的调整。
  • 用户权限:为确保安全性,用户可以配置不同角色的权限,以限制未授权访问。

问题与解答

以下是关于 Tokenim 安装和配置的五个常见问题及其详细解答:

如何解决安装过程中出现的依赖错误?

在安装过程中,用户可能会遇到依赖错误。这通常是由于 Node.js 或 npm 版本不兼容导致的。解决这一问题,可以采取以下步骤:

  1. 检查 Node.js 版本:确保安装的 Node.js 版本符合 Tokenim 的要求。可以使用命令
    node -v
    来查看当前版本。如果版本过低,可以访问 Node.js 官方网站下载最新版本。
  2. 更新 npm:运行
    npm install -g npm@latest
    命令来更新 npm,以便获得最新的功能和修复。
  3. 删除 node_modules 目录:如果依赖包冲突,可以删除项目目录下的 node_modules 文件夹,然后重新执行 npm install 命令。

通过遵循以上步骤,用户通常可以成功解决大部分依赖问题,顺利完成安装。

如何配置 Tokenim 的数据库连接?

在使用 Tokenim 之前,配置数据库连接是至关重要的。Tokenim 支持多种类型的数据库,例如 MySQL、PostgreSQL 等。以下是配置数据库连接的步骤:

  1. 选择数据库:根据项目需求选择合适的数据库,并确保该数据库已安装和运行。
  2. 创建数据库:在所选的数据库管理系统中创建一个新的数据库供 Tokenim 使用。
  3. 配置连接信息:在 Tokenim 的配置文件中,找到与数据库连接相关的段落,并输入数据库的名称、用户名、密码和主机地址。例如:
    DB_NAME=your_database_name
  4. 测试连接:完成配置后,可以通过启动 Tokenim 并观察是否能成功连接到数据库来确认配置是否正确。

通过以上步骤,用户可以为 Tokenim 配置一个稳定的数据库连接,确保其正常运行。

Tokenim 支持哪些区块链网络?

Tokenim 设计时考虑到了多样化,支持多种区块链网络,包括但不限于以下几种:

  • 以太坊:Tokenim 支持以太坊主链及其测试网络,用户可以轻松创建以太坊 Token。
  • BSC(币安智能链):用户可以在 BSC 上创建和管理金融合约,利用其低手续费的特点。
  • Polygon(原 Matic):作为以太坊的扩展解决方案,Polygon 允许用户在侧链上高效执行合约。

选择合适的区块链网络取决于用户的具体需求,包括成本、速度和智能合约功能等。Tokenim 提供灵活性,让用户可以根据项目需求选择最适合的网络。

安装后如何验证 Tokenim 是否正常运行?

完成安装后,确保 Tokenim 正常工作是非常重要的。用户可以通过以下几种方式进行验证:

  1. 查看终端输出:如果看到终端中显示 Tokenim 启动成功的信息,通常表明安装正确。
  2. 访问用户界面:打开浏览器,访问 Tokenim 的默认地址,检查界面是否可以正常加载。
  3. 检查数据连接:创建一个新的 Token 或合约,查看是否可以与数据库进行交互。
  4. 查阅日志文件:Tokenim 生成的日志文件中会记录正常运行和错误信息,查看这些日志可以帮助确认系统状态。

通过以上方式,用户可以检查和确认 Tokenim 是否已成功安装,并能顺利启动和运行。

如何处理升级过程中的问题?

在区块链领域,软件的更新和升级是必不可少的,然而在这个过程中,用户可能会面临一些问题。为此,以下是一些处理升级时常见问题的建议:

  1. 备份数据:在执行任何升级之前,务必备份数据,例如数据库和配置文件,以免出现意外情况导致数据丢失。
  2. 阅读更新说明:在升级前,仔细阅读更新日志和说明,以了解每个版本的主要变化和注意事项。
  3. 逐步升级:如果 Tokenim 有较大版本更新,建议逐个小版本进行升级,避免直接跳跃到最新版本造成的兼容性问题。
  4. 测试新版本:在生产环境之外的非关键环境中测试新版本的性能和稳定性,确认无误后再推进到生产环境。

通过上述步骤,用户可以最大程度地减少升级过程中的风险,确保系统的平稳过渡。

总结

Tokenim 是一个强大的工具,可帮助用户在区块链上创建和管理数字资产。通过正确的安装和配置,用户可以顺利地开始自己的区块链开发之旅。无论遇到哪种问题,只要保持冷静,逐步排查,通常都能找到解决方案。掌握 Tokenim 的使用技巧,可以为未来的加密项目打下坚实的基础。